Event planning ranks as one of the most stressful jobs in the world, according to CareerCast, an online career site that uses an 11-point stress test that includes categories like travel, working in the public eye, meeting the public, and deadlines. Easy to see why event and meeting planning repeatedly makes the list.

In addition to operating standalone spas throughout the U.S. and Caribbean, exhale has become a familiar brand inside hotels such as the Fairmont Miramar Hotel and Bungalows in Santa Monica, CA; Hamilton Princess & Beach Club in Bermuda; the Gansevoort properties in New York; Battery Wharf Hotel Boston Waterfront; Loews Hotels in Atlanta and South Beach, FL; and The Ritz-Carlton and Kimpton EPIC Hotel in Miami. exhale also recently partnered with Lindblad Expeditions, offering wellbeing cruises. Two years ago, Hyatt bought exhale, which operates as a standalone brand within Hyatt’s wellness category.
